Description of problem: Due to I/O issues during image conversion job when a volume gets created it is intended to separate cinder service (especially cinder-volume) from the core pacemaker cluster to be run on 2 separate nodes using pacemaker_remote. This BZ is to log testing of such a scenario to separate A/P services using composable services/roles.
